Truy vấn và trực quan hóa dữ liệu theo cấp bậc
Chủ đề này áp dụng cho Dynamics 365 Customer Engagement (on-premises). Đối với phiên bản Power Apps thuộc chủ đề này, hãy xem: Truy vấn và trực quan hóa dữ liệu liên quan theo thứ bậc
Bạn có thể có được những biểu biết có giá trị về kinh doanh bằng cách trực quan hóa dữ liệu có phân cấp liên quan. Các khả năng trực quan hóa và lập mô hình theo cấp bậc mang lại cho bạn một số lợi ích sau:
Xem và khám phá thông tin phân cấp phức tạp.
Xem chỉ số đo lường hiệu suất chính (KPI) trong hiển thị theo ngữ cảnh của một cấu trúc phân cấp.
Phân tích trực quan thông tin quan trọng trên các trang web và các máy tính bảng.
Cho một số thực thể, chẳng hạn như tài khoản và người dùng, các hiển thị trực quan được cung cấp một cách sáng tạo. Các thực thể khác, bao gồm các thực thể tùy chỉnh, có thể được kích hoạt cho một cấu trúc phân cấp và bạn có thể tạo các hiển thị trực quan cho chúng. Căn cứ vào nhu cầu, bạn có thể lựa chọn giữa dạng xem cây, nghĩa là hiển thị toàn bộ cấu trúc phân cấp hoặc xem dạng ngăn xếpp, nghĩa là mô tả một phần nhỏ hơn trong cấu trúc phân cấp. Cả hai dạng xem được hiển thị cạnh nhau. Bạn có thể khám phá một hệ thống phân cấp bởi mở rộng và hợp đồng một cây phân cấp. Các thiết đặt theo cấp bậc giống nhau đối với hiển thị trực quan được thiết lập một lần nhưng áp dụng cho cả máy khách di động và web. Trong máy tính bảng, các hình ảnh hiển thị ở định dạng sửa đổi thích hợp cho hệ số biểu mẫu nhỏ hơn. Các thành phần có thể tùy chỉnh cần thiết cho kiểu trực quan phân cấp là giải pháp nhận thức, do đó, chúng có thể được di chuyển giữa các tổ chức như bất cứ tùy chỉnh nào khác. Bạn có thể đặt cấu hình các thuộc tính hiển thị trong kiểu trực quan bằng cách tùy chỉnh Biểu mẫu Nhanh sử dụng công cụ biên tập biểu mẫu. Không có yêu cầu viết mã.
Dữ liệu phân cấp truy vấn
Cấu trúc dữ liệu theo cấp bậc được hỗ trợ bởi các mối quan hệ một-cho-nhiều (1:N) tự tham chiếu của các hồ sơ có liên quan. Trong quá khứ, để xem dữ liệu phân cấp, bạn phải lặp đi lặp lại truy vấn cho các bản ghi liên quan. Hiện nay, bạn có thể truy vấn các dữ liệu có liên quan như là một hệ thống phân cấp, trong một bước. Bạn sẽ có thể truy vấn các bản ghi bằng cách sử dụng logic Dưới và Không Dưới . Toán tử phân cấp Dưới và Không Dưới được hiển thị trong Tìm kiếm nâng cao và trình chỉnh sửa quy trình làm việc. Để biết thêm thông tin về cách sử dụng các toán tử này, hãy xem Định cấu hình các bước quy trình làm việc. Để biết thêm thông tin về Tìm kiếm nâng cao, hãy xem Tạo, chỉnh sửa hoặc lưu tìm kiếm Tìm kiếm nâng cao
Các ví dụ sau minh họa các kịch bản khác nhau cho các truy vấn hệ thống phân cấp:
Truy vấn hệ thống phân cấp tài khoản
Truy vấn hệ thống phân cấp tài khoản, bao gồm cả hoạt động liên quan
Truy vấn hệ thống phân cấp tài khoản, bao gồm cả cơ hội liên quan
Để truy vấn dữ liệu dưới dạng hệ thống phân cấp, bạn phải đặt một trong các mối quan hệ tự tham chiếu một-cho-nhiều (1:N) của thực thể dưới dạng phân cấp. Để bật hệ thống cấp bậc:
Mở trình khám phá giải pháp.
Chọn thực thể bạn muốn, chọn Mối quan hệ 1:N, sau đó chọn mối quan hệ (1:N).
Trong Định nghĩa mối quan hệ, đặt Phân cấp thành Có.
Lưu ý
- Một số mối quan hệ (1:N) sáng tạo không thể được tùy chỉnh. Điều này sẽ ngăn cản bạn đặt những mối quan hệ đó là phân cấp.
- Bạn có thể chỉ định mối quan hệ theo cấp bậc cho mối quan hệ tự tham chiếu hệ thống. Điều này bao gồm các mối quan hệ tự tham chiếu 1:N của loại hệ thống, chẳng hạn như mối quan hệ "contact_master_contact".
Hiển thị trực quan dữ liệu phân cấp
Các thực thể hệ thống có sẵn hình ảnh trực quan ngay lập tức bao gồm Account
, Position
, Product
và User
. Trong dạng xem lưới của các thực thể này, bạn có thể thấy biểu tượng mô tả biểu đồ hệ thống phân cấp ở bên trái của tên bản ghi. Biểu tượng hệ thống phân cấp không hiển thị cho tất cả bản ghi theo mặc định. Biểu tượng này được hiển thị cho các bản ghi có bản ghi mẹ, bản ghi con hoặc cả hai.
Nếu chọn biểu tượng hệ thống phân cấp, bạn có thể xem hệ thống phân cấp, với dạng xem cây phía bên trái và xem ngăn xếp bên phải, như hình dưới đây:
Một vài thực thể hệ thống sáng tạo khác có thể được kích hoạt cho một hệ thống phân cấp. Các thực thể này bao gồm Case
, Contact
, Opportunity
, Order
, Quote
, Campaign
, và Team
. Tất cả các thực thể tùy chỉnh có thể được kích hoạt cho hệ thống phân cấp.
Tiền bo
Nếu thực thể có thể được kích hoạt cho hệ thống phân cấp:
Trong trình khám phá giải pháp, mở rộng thực thể mà bạn muốn. Bạn sẽ thấy thành phần thực thể có tên Cài đặt hệ thống phân cấp. Không thể bật các thực thể cho hệ thống cấp bậc không có thành phần này, ngoại trừ thực thể Lãnh thổ bán hàng của Dynamics 365 Customer Engagement (on-premises). Mặc dù Cài đặt hệ thống phân cấp xuất hiện cho thực thể Lãnh thổ bán hàng nhưng không thể bật thực thể này cho hệ thống phân cấp.
Điều quan trọng cần nhớ khi bạn tạo kiểu trực quan:
Chỉ một mối quan hệ tự tham chiếu (1: N) cho mỗi thực thể có thể được đặt là phân cấp. Trong mối quan hệ này, thực thể chính và thực thể liên quan phải cùng loại, chẳng hạn như account_parent_account hoặc new_new_widget_new_widget.
Hiện nay, một hệ thống phân cấp hoặc hiển thị trực quan được dựa trên chỉ một thực thể. Bạn có thể mô tả hệ thống phân cấp tài khoản hiển thị các tài khoản ở nhiều cấp; tuy nhiên, bạn không thể hiển thị tài khoản và liên hệ trong cùng một hiển thị trực quan hệ thống phân cấp.
Số trường tối đa có thể hiển thị trong một ngăn xếp là ba trường với Giao diện Hợp nhất và bốn trường với ứng dụng khách web cũ. Nếu bạn thêm nhiều trường hơn vào Biểu mẫu Nhanh được sử dụng cho dạng xem ngăn xếp, chỉ bốn trường sẽ được hiển thị.
Ví dụ về hiển thị trực quan
Hãy xem một ví dụ về việc tạo hiển thị trực quan cho một thực thể tùy chỉnh. Chúng tôi đã tạo một thực thể tùy chỉnh có tên là new_Widget, tạo mối quan hệ tự tham chiếu (1:N) new_new_widget_new_widget và đánh dấu nó là có thứ bậc, như minh họa ở đây.
Tiếp theo, trong chế độ xem lưới Cài đặt phân cấp , chúng tôi đã chọn new_new_widget_new_widget mối quan hệ phân cấp. Trong biểu mẫu, chúng tôi điền vào các trường bắt buộc. Nếu bạn đã không đánh dấu mối quan hệ (1:N) là phân cấp, liên kết trên biểu mẫu sẽ đưa bạn quay lại biểu mẫu định nghĩa mối quan hệ, nơi bạn có thể đánh dấu mối quan hệ là phân cấp.
Đối với biểu mẫu xem nhanh, chúng tôi đã tạo Biểu mẫu nhanh có tên là tiện ích Biểu mẫu ngăn xếp thứ bậc. Trong biểu mẫu này, chúng tôi đã thêm bốn trường để hiển thị trong mỗi ngăn xếp.
Sau khi hoàn tất việc thiết lập, chúng tôi đã tạo hai bản ghi: Tiện ích Chuẩn và Tiện ích Cao cấp. Sau khi tạo Tiện ích Cao cấp, bản ghi mẹ của Tiện ích Chuẩn bằng cách sử dụng trường tra cứu, dạng xem dạng lưới new_Widget mô tả các biểu tượng hệ thống phân cấp, như hình dưới đây:
Tiền bo
Các biểu tượng hệ thống phân cấp không xuất hiện trong dạng xem dạng lưới bản ghi cho đến khi các bản ghi được kết hợp trong mối quan hệ bản ghi mẹ-con.
Chọn biểu tượng hệ thống phân cấp làm hiển thị hệ thống phân cấp new_Widget với dạng xem cây phía bên trái và xem ngăn xếp bên phải, hiển thị hai bản ghi. Mỗi ô chứa bốn trường mà chúng tôi đã cung cấp trong tiện ích Biểu mẫu ô xếp thứ bậc.
Xem thêm
Phản hồi
https://aka.ms/ContentUserFeedback.
Sắp ra mắt: Trong năm 2024, chúng tôi sẽ dần gỡ bỏ Sự cố với GitHub dưới dạng cơ chế phản hồi cho nội dung và thay thế bằng hệ thống phản hồi mới. Để biết thêm thông tin, hãy xem:Gửi và xem ý kiến phản hồi dành cho